I think at its best the American sense of humor is the same as the British sense of humor at its best, which is to be wry and ironic and self deprecating.
We use cookies to understand our websites traffic and offer our website visitors personalized experience. To find out more, click ‘More Information’. In addition, please, read our
Privacy policy.